(MUNICIPALITY OF HURON EAST, ON) – A member of the Huron County OPP has been issued a Provincial Offence notice following a collision Wednesday, Oct. 14, at 4:50 p.m.
Investigation revealed that the officer had just completed a traffic stop when he attempted to make a U-turn on Brussels Line. The fully-marked police cruiser collided with a southbound vehicle which then rolled and came to rest on its side.
Neither driver was injured; however, both vehicles sustained significant damage.
As a result of the investigation, the OPP has provincial constable Greg BLACKWELL with “Start from a stopped position – not in safety,” contrary to section 142(2) of the Highway Traffic Act. He has served with the OPP for just over one year.
